What effect did trade have on the Phoenicians

History
1 answer:
son4ous [18]4 years ago
5 0

The trading civilization of Phoenicia resulted in a network of colonies such as Carthage and expanded the Phoenician influence around the Mediterranean. It also spread ideas, goods, and settlements around the Mediterranean.

What is the Talmud, and why is it<br> significant? PLS HELP ME
ryzh [129]

Answer:

The Talmud is the source from which the code of Jewish Halakhah (law) is derived. It is made up of the Mishnah and the Gemara. The Mishnah is the original written version of the oral law and the Gemara is the record of the rabbinic discussions following this writing down. It includes their differences of view

Why was the defeat at Vicksburg a significant loss for the Confederate Army?
Lena [83]

Answer:

Option C, It allowed the Union Army to have total control of the Mississippi River, is the right answer.

Explanation:

During the Civil war, the battle of Vicksburg was one of the major victories of the Union. This battle took place between 18th May 1863 until July 4, 1863. In this battle, the Union forces were led by commander  General Ulysses S. Grant while the Confederate forces were led by General John Pemberton. The outcome of the battle can be seen in the fact that the Union Army established its total control over the Mississippi river.
